| Common Name | 25-Epiruizgenin 3-[4''-rhamnosylglucoside] |
|---|
| Description | 25-Epiruizgenin 3-[4''-rhamnosylglucoside] belongs to the class of organic compounds known as steroidal saponins. These are saponins in which the aglycone moiety is a steroid. The steroidal aglycone is usually a spirostane, furostane, spirosolane, solanidane, or curcubitacin derivative. Based on a literature review a significant number of articles have been published on 25-Epiruizgenin 3-[4''-rhamnosylglucoside]. |
